Abstract

The invention discloses an internal connection type curtain wall keel duplex connection structure which comprises a vertical keel and a transverse keel connected to one side of the vertical keel through a connection assembly, wherein the vertical keel is provided with more than one insertion hole, the transverse keel is provided with a transverse inward expansion groove, the connection assembly comprises a connection piece which is positioned in the transverse inward expansion groove, can move along the transverse inward expansion groove and rotate relative to the transverse inward expansion groove, the connection piece is provided with an insertion part inserted into the insertion hole corresponding to each insertion hole, the vertical keel and the connection piece are fixedly connected through a first fastening assembly, and the transverse keel and the connection piece are fixedly connected through a second fastening assembly. The invention has the advantages of simple and convenient assembly and disassembly, high connection strength, high stability and reliability, low cost, simple and delicate appearance of the curtain wall and the like.

Background
At present, the connection of horizontal keel and vertical keel in the curtain wall in the market is mainly splicing and welding. Wherein, the concatenation is divided into two kinds again: one is a sub-unit sequential installation mode, namely, a first vertical keel is installed at first, and then a transverse keel and a vertical keel are alternately installed on the side surface of the first vertical keel in sequence until the installation of the whole curtain wall is completed; the other mode is a transverse keel after-loading mode, namely all the vertical keels of the curtain wall are installed according to the set interval size, and then the transverse keels between the adjacent vertical keels are installed. The former mounting method has a disadvantage that once an error occurs after the installation of the curtain wall or once other factors need to replace the keel, all the keels after the replacement position need to be disassembled, otherwise the keels cannot be taken out, and accumulated errors easily occur in the sequential installation of the units, which causes a large deviation of the separation size between the vertical keels installed at last, for example, 50 partitions exist in the curtain wall installed from left to right, if the length of each transverse keel is reduced by 3mm, each separation size (the distance between adjacent vertical keels) is also reduced by 3mm, and the final error accumulation can reach 150mm. The horizontal keel between the vertical keels is installed again after the whole installation of the vertical keels is completed in the latter installation mode, the keels needing to be replaced only by corresponding dismounting during replacement of any keel are needed, and accumulated errors cannot occur in the installation mode.
However, the existing curtain wall technology after installing the cross keel is not mature enough, and has the following defects:
1. connecting pieces and screws between the keels are difficult to hide, most of the connecting pieces and the screws are exposed outside, so that the installation of the curtain wall plate is influenced, and the appearance of the curtain wall after installation is not concise and exquisite;
2. the required connecting piece of connection and screw between the fossil fragments are in large quantity, lead to the dismouting degree of difficulty big, inefficiency to still need set up a large amount of fastening mounting holes on the fossil fragments, can cause the influence to the intensity of fossil fragments, also can reduce the rust-resistant performance of fossil fragments.

Compared with the prior art, the invention has the advantages that: the internal connection type curtain wall keel duplex connection structure can realize the after-loading and the independent disassembly of the cross keel, can realize the disassembly and the assembly only by adjusting the connecting piece to ensure that the insertion part of the connecting piece is inserted into or withdrawn from the insertion hole of the vertical keel and disassembling the first fastening component and the second fastening component, has fewer disassembly and assembly steps, is simple and convenient to operate, and can greatly improve the disassembly and the assembly efficiency. Simultaneously, the grafting portion of connecting piece inserts in the spliced eye of erecting the fossil fragments, and the connecting piece is arranged in the horizontal internal expanding recess of horizontal fossil fragments, and this kind of connection structure's joint strength, stability and reliability are high, even the connection failure horizontal fossil fragments of fastener also can not drop, and the security is better. And, the connecting piece is hidden in the inside of vertical keel and horizontal keel, can not influence the installation of curtain board, does benefit to the succinct exquisite nature that improves after the curtain installation.

Example 1:
as shown in fig. 1 to 3, the internal connection type curtain wall keel duplex connection structure of this embodiment, including the furring channel 1 and connect in the cross keel 2 of the furring channel 1 one side through coupling assembling, the furring channel 1 has more than one spliced eye 10, the cross keel 2 has the horizontal internal expanding groove 21, coupling assembling is including being arranged in the horizontal internal expanding groove 21 and can follow the horizontal internal expanding groove 21 and remove and expand the recess 21 pivoted connecting piece 3 for the horizontal internal expanding groove 21, connecting piece 3 corresponds every spliced eye 10 and all is equipped with grafting portion 31 that inserts in the spliced eye 10, the furring channel 1 and connecting piece 3 are through first fastening components fixed connection, cross keel 2 and connecting piece 3 are through second fastening components fixed connection. During the installation, pack into earlier connecting piece 3 in the horizontal internal expanding recess 21 of horizontal fossil fragments 2, then remove connecting piece 3 and make its grafting portion 31 insert spliced eye 10, adopt first fastening components fixed connection vertical joist 1 and connecting piece 3, second fastening components fixed connection horizontal joist 2 and connecting piece 3 again can. Before the first fastening component and the second fastening component are installed, the cross keel 2 is supported in the inserting hole 10 of the vertical keel 1 through the connecting piece 3, manual supporting of the cross keel 2 is not needed, and installation is labor-saving and convenient.
In this embodiment, the first fastening component is a first fastening screw 101, and the first fastening screw 101 directly connects the fastening furring channel 1 and the inserting part 31. The second fastening assembly comprises a fifth fastening screw 105, the fifth fastening screw 105 is inserted into the transverse inward-expanding groove 21 from the notch of the transverse inward-expanding groove 21 and connected with the connecting piece 3, a gasket 1051 is sleeved on the fifth fastening screw 105, the fifth fastening screw 105 forces the gasket 1051 and the connecting piece 3 to clamp and fix the cross keel 2, wherein the gasket 1051 is tightly attached to the outer wall of the cross keel 2, and the connecting piece 3 is tightly attached to the inner wall of the transverse inward-expanding groove 21, so that the cross keel 2 is clamped and fixed. The second fastening component adopts the fixed cross keel 2 of clamping mode, need not trompil on the cross keel 2, can not influence the intensity of cross keel 2, and the rust-resistant ability of cross keel 2 is better. In other embodiments, the washer 1051 may be omitted and the cross runner 2 may be clamped and fixed only by the screw head of the fifth fastening screw 105 engaging with the connector 3.
In this embodiment, the horizontal inward-expanding groove 21 is composed of a bottom groove body and a top groove body, and the maximum width of the cross section of the bottom groove body is larger than that of the top groove body. The spliced eye 10 on the vertical keel 1 is the round hole, and the round hole is punched conveniently, and is little to vertical keel 1's intensity influence, and connecting piece 3 is an arc slat, and connecting piece 3 can slide and rotate in spliced eye 10 along round hole form spliced eye 10, and this connecting piece 3 has the cambered surface of the spliced eye 10 inner wall laminating with the round hole form, can improve the stability of being connected with vertical keel 1. The cross section of the bottom groove body of the transverse inward-expanding groove 21 is semicircular, and the connecting piece 3 can move along the transverse inward-expanding groove 21 and rotate in the transverse inward-expanding groove 21.
